KeymasterChecked both Max Payne 3 and Arkham City, could not reproduce your issue though.
Arkham City ideally should be run with DX9 (DX11 off in the game launcher). I’ll automate that for the next vorpX. Also make sure to disable 3D-Vision if you happen to have that enabled, in the game launcher and in your nVidia control panel.
Also ideally use the Arkham City GOTY edition on Steam. That’s the one that the profile was made with. Shadow/HUD etc. definitions might fail with other editions if the game’s shaders were recompiled for different editions. That might explain the glitches you got.
For Max Payne 3 it’s the other way around. Best to run the game with DX11. vorpX should already do that automatically, but if that fails or you have disabled auto settings, make sure DX11 is set in the game’s graphics options.
Unrelated: For Arkham City you might want to download the ‘Batman: Arkham City [vorpX]’ profile from the cloud. While I was at it I made a few minor changes.

KeymasterTry to run Max Payne 3 windowed (‘Fullscreen’ set to ‘Off’ in its graphis options). That should fix it.
There currently is a bug that affects a handful of DX11 games when run in fullscreen mode. The bug is already fixed in my current dev build, that’s why I didn’t encounter the issue when I checked the game first.
Running the game windowed helps until the next vorpX later this week.
